Taib was national political icon, says Shafie


KOTA KINABALU: Tun Abdul Taib Mahmud was a national political icon, who contributed not only to his home state but also to the country, says Datuk Seri Shafie Apdal.

In expressing his condolences to the bereaved family and all in Sarawak for the passing of the former state governor, Shafie said other than serving as Sarawak chief minister, Taib had held other federal portfolios including as Information minister and Defence minister.

“He also managed to unite the diverse cultures and people of Sarawak under one governance,” he said.

“As we know, when Abdul Taib was the Sarawak chief minister, he put a lot of effort into bringing the people together as one, regardless of them being Bidayus, Ibans, Malays, Melanaus and others,” said Shafie.

He said Abdul Taib had played an important role in developing Sarawak into what it is today.

“I pray that his soul be blessed and placed among the righteous,” he added.

Abdul Taib passed away at a private hospital in Kuala Lumpur around 4.40am, Wednesday (Feb 21).
